(a) 'Consumer contract', which includes writings required to complete the consumer transaction, means a written agreement in which a natural person:\n(1) leases or licenses personal property or leases real property for residential purposes;\n(2) obtains credit;\n(3) obtains personal insurance coverage;\n(4) borrows money;\n(5) purchases personal property; or\n(6) contracts for services, including professional services, for cash, or on credit; and the credit, money, property or services are obtained for personal, family or household purposes.\n(b) 'Primary regulator' means a territorial agency or person that has licensing or general regulatory authority over a creditor, seller, insurer or lessor. General business license authority shall not be considered the primary regulator, unless no other territorial agency has regulatory authority.
